French door glass replacement services involve removing and replacing the glass panels within existing French doors. This process typically includes carefully taking out the damaged or broken glass, cleaning the frame, and installing new, clear, or decorative glass to restore the door’s appearance and functionality. Service providers may also inspect the door frame and seal to ensure the new glass is properly secured and weather-tight. This service is designed to improve the door’s aesthetic appeal, enhance energy efficiency, and prevent further damage caused by cracked or shattered glass.

Many homeowners seek French door glass replacement to address issues such as cracked, foggy, or broken glass panes that compromise the door’s appearance and security. Damaged glass can also lead to drafts, higher energy bills, and increased noise levels. Replacing the glass can effectively resolve these problems while avoiding the need to replace the entire door. This service is often a practical solution for doors that have suffered accidental damage or wear over time, helping restore both function and visual appeal.

The overview below groups typical French Door Glass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Piscataway, NJ.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or glass replacements in French doors range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, depending on glass type and door style. Fewer projects reach into the higher end of the spectrum.

Standard Full Replacement - Replacing an entire French door with new glass gener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Most homeowners in Piscataway find their projects fall within this range, with larger or custom doors pushing costs higher.

Larger or Custom Projects - Custom glass or larger French doors can cost $3,500 to $6,000 or more. Such projects are less common but may be necessary for unique sizes, styles, or added features like energy-efficient glass.

Complex or High-End Installations - High-end or complex replacements, including specialty glass or intricate door designs, can exceed $6,000. These tend to be less frequent but are handled by local contractors for clients seeking premium options.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of glass are available for French door replacements? Local contractors often offer a variety of glass options, including tempered, laminated, and decorative glass, to suit different aesthetic and security needs.

Can I choose energy-efficient glass for my French doors? Yes, many service providers can install energy-efficient glass, such as low-E or insulated glass, to improve insulation and reduce energy costs.

Is it possible to replace only a damaged panel in my French door? In many cases, local contractors can replace just the damaged glass panel, which can be a cost-effective solution compared to replacing the entire door.

Are custom sizes available for French door glass replacements? Custom-sized glass panels are often available through local service providers to ensure a perfect fit for unique door dimensions.

What should I consider when selecting glass for my French door replacement? Factors like safety, insulation, privacy, and style are important; local pros can help identify the best options based on these considerations.
